Frameless Shower Doors UK: Overview and Benefits
Frameless shower doors are a popular choice for modern bathrooms, renowned for their sleek appearance and minimalistic design. Constructed from thick, tempered glass, these doors offer a polished and seamless look, which can make a bathroom feel more spacious.
Benefits:
– Stylish Aesthetic: Frameless designs lend an air of elegance and sophistication.
– Easier Cleaning: Without frames, there are fewer crevices for dirt and soap scum to accumulate, making maintenance straightforward.
– Versatile Design: These doors can fit any design style, from contemporary to traditional.
However, potential buyers should consider that frameless shower doors typically require professional installation due to their weight and complexity.
Bi-Fold Shower Doors UK: Space-Saving Solutions
Bi-fold shower doors are an excellent option for smaller bathrooms where space is a concern. These doors operate by folding inwards, allowing them to take up minimal space when open.
Benefits:
– Compact Design: Ideal for tight layouts, these doors open without additional clearance space.
– Maximal Access: They provide unobstructed access to the shower area, particularly beneficial for individuals with mobility issues.
– Stylish Options Available: Bi-fold doors come in various finishes and styles to match your bathroom décor.
If you value function over form, bi-fold doors can be a practical addition to your bathroom space.
Sliding Shower Doors UK: Functionality Meets Style
Sliding shower doors are versatile and stylish, providing the convenience of easy access to the shower without swinging open or closed. This is particularly useful in bathrooms where space is at a premium.
Benefits:
– User-Friendly: Sliding doors are simple to operate, ideal for families and those with mobility challenges.
– Wide Enclosure Options: These doors can encompass larger shower areas, making them a perfect choice for spacious layouts.
– Design Versatility: They are available in various glass types, finishes, and frame styles to enhance the overall bathroom aesthetic.
By considering your available space and personal style, sliding shower doors can be just the right fit for your needs.

Assessing Space: Measuring and Fitting
Before making a purchase, measuring the shower area accurately is crucial. This involves:
1. Width Measurement: Measure the width at the top and bottom of the shower opening to determine the proper size.
2. Height Measurement: Measure from the top of the shower base to the point where the door will attach to the wall.
3. Consider Irregularities: Account for any imperfections or irregularities in the walls that may affect fitting.
Proper measurements ensure that your new shower doors fit perfectly and operate seamlessly.
Material Choices: Glass, Acrylic, and More
The material of your chosen shower doors can significantly affect both their appearance and longevity.
– Tempered Glass: Known for its strength and durability, tempered glass can withstand heat and impact, making it a popular choice.
– Acrylic: Lightweight and less expensive than glass, acrylic can simulate the look of glass while being easier to manage.
– Composite Materials: Some shower doors feature composites that provide the appearance of glass without the same weight, offering a balance between cost and style.
Choosing the right material is essential for durability and maintaining the look you desire.

Common Mistakes to Avoid During Installation
Certain pitfalls can derail the installation process if not carefully managed:
– Incorrect Measurements: Double-check all measurements to avoid purchasing the wrong size doors.
– Neglecting Sealing: Failing to apply appropriate sealant can lead to leaks and water damage.
– Overlooking Leveling: Ensure that the door frame is level during installation so that doors operate smoothly.
By being aware of these common mistakes, you can enhance your chances of achieving a seamless installation.

Innovative Features: Smart Glass Technology
Technology is making its way into bathroom design. Smart glass technology offers exciting possibilities:
– Frosting on Demand: This technology allows glass to switch from clear to frosted with the flip of a switch, providing privacy when needed while maintaining elegance.
– Self-Cleaning Glass: Some advanced glass coatings repel water spots and stains, simplifying maintenance.
These innovations add convenience and luxury to the shower experience.
